Honoré Daumier, a master of the medium, depicts a seated porcelain figure of a Chinese deity, often referred to as a magot in nineteenth-century French parlance. The work is part of a series that drew upon objects from the private collection of Charles Philipon, the publisher of La Caricature.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eDaumier employs a sophisticated use of light and shadow to render the glossy, rounded surfaces of the ceramic sculpture. The figure is presented in a frontal, seated posture, with a pronounced belly and a serene, slightly mocking expression. The artist captures the texture of the material through careful shading, creating a sense of volume that makes the figure appear three-dimensional against the dark, void-like background. The inclusion of prayer beads and the specific folds of the robes demonstrate Daumier's attention to detail, even when working within the constraints of political and social satire.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eDuring this period, Daumier was deeply involved in the critique of the July Monarchy. While this specific print appears to be a study of an object, it reflects the broader cultural fascination with exoticism and the collection of curiosities that permeated Parisian intellectual circles. The print serves as an example of Daumier's technical proficiency in lithography, a medium he used to reach a wide audience through the press. The stark contrast between the illuminated figure and the deep black background draws the viewer's attention to the physical form of the statue, inviting a close examination of the artist's handling of tone and form.
